Transaction 966c60ffbc06e5657709433023dacced214331c6a5824b43a4d8b8bc17d17efb
1 Input
1 Output
-
966c60ffbc06e5657709433023dacced214331c6a5824b43a4d8b8bc17d17efb:0
- value
- 553313525
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ec6f86ce32c7ff9b01115f089bd2151dcf71c10 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19e8sjqhHiBDxhm8n2kun5dwHhDDEVfdK7